Teamwork and Collective Growth

Individual growth is amplified by the collective dynamic of Class 3-E. Thee students come from diverse backgrounds and personality types, yet their shared mission creates a bond that transcends initial differences. Azhh cooperation, they learn thee value of intercontraince over toxic self-reliance.
